MISS BATTEN IN SWEDEN
* AERO CLUB DECORATION PRESENTED RECOGNITION OF RECORD
FLIGHTS
(Received March 7, 11.30 p.m.)
STOCKHOLM, March 7,
Miss Jean Batten, who is making a lecture tour of Sweden, delivered a public lecture in Stockholm last night before a huge audience, which included Prince Gustav Adolf, son of the Crown Prince.
She was given a wonderful reception. Prince Gustav Adolf presented her with a gold medal awarded, only on rare occasions, by the Swedish Aero Club in recognition of her record flights.
